Inside the GPT-5.6 Family: Sol, Terra, and Luna

The GPT-5.6 series is designed to offer flexibility, letting you match model capability, cost, and performance to specific workloads. Here's the breakdown:

  • GPT-5.6 Sol: The most advanced reasoning model, built for extended reasoning, agentic workflows, and code-focused scenarios. Ideal for the most demanding enterprise tasks.
  • GPT-5.6 Terra: A balanced model for everyday work, offering competitive performance at a lower cost. Perfect for scaling intelligent applications across the enterprise.
  • GPT-5.6 Luna: The fastest and most affordable model, optimized for high-volume, latency-sensitive workloads.

Pricing Table

Here's the official pricing (USD per million tokens) for standard global deployments:

ModelInputCached InputCached WritesOutput
GPT-5.6 Sol (short context)$5.00$0.50$6.25$30.00
GPT-5.6 Terra (short context)$2.00$0.20$2.50$12.00
GPT-5.6 Luna (short context)$0.20$0.02$0.25$1.20

This pricing reflects the latest discounts announced by OpenAI on 7/30. For Data Zone and Priority Processing prices, you'll need to contact your sales rep.

Deployment Options

All three models are available through:

  • Global Standard and Global Priority Processing across all 28 existing global regions
  • Data Zones Standard
  • Global Provisioned from day one

This means you can adopt the latest frontier AI innovations where you've already built and scaled your applications, without re-architecting your infrastructure.

The Strategic Implications: More Than Just Models

While the GPT-5.6 series is the flashy headline, the deeper story is about platform convergence. Foundry is not just a model marketplace; it's a production runtime with enterprise-grade governance.

Key Updates Beyond the Models

  • Hosted Agents GA: One production runtime for agents built with any framework. Includes VNet integration for network isolation, and resilient task support (private preview) for long-running workloads.
  • APAC Data Zone GA: Regional data processing for APAC customers, addressing sovereignty and compliance needs.
  • Toolboxes GA: Dynamically selects the right tool for each request, reducing token overhead.
  • Memory and Routines (Public Preview): Agents can now remember context across interactions and act on schedules or event-based triggers.
  • Publishing to Microsoft 365 Copilot and Teams (GA next week): Agents reach users where they already work.
  • Agent Optimizer (Public Preview): Automatically tests prompts, skills, models, and tools to find better configurations, often while reducing costs.
  • ROI for Agents (Private Preview): Connects traces, business value, and operating cost into a single dashboard.

The "Build vs. Buy" Question

Foundry's approach is to provide a comprehensive platform, but this raises a question: are you locking yourself into Microsoft's ecosystem? The support for multiple frameworks (LangGraph, Claude Agent SDK, etc.) mitigates this, but the tight integration with Azure and Microsoft 365 is a double-edged sword. It's powerful if you're already a Microsoft shop, but potentially limiting if you're not.

Limitations and Caveats

  • Cost Management: While the optimizer helps, costs can spiral if you're not careful. The ROI dashboard is still in private preview, so you need to build your own cost tracking initially.
  • Lock-in Concerns: Deep integration with Microsoft ecosystem may be a concern for multi-cloud strategies.
  • New Features in Preview: Many exciting features (Memory, Routines, Agent Optimizer) are still in preview, so they may not be production-ready for all use cases.
